Family friendly hiking trails around Kratzeburg are set within the Mecklenburg Lake District, offering diverse natural environments for outdoor activities. The region is characterized by extensive forests, numerous lakes, and varied wildlife, providing a range of terrain for hikers. Kratzeburg is situated within the Müritz National Park, which features ancient forests and approximately 100 lakes. The landscape includes wide forests, some with ancient trees, and tranquil moors, creating a picturesque backdrop for family friendly hikes.

The village of Liepen can look back on a long history. It was first mentioned in documents in 1386. While Gothic brick churches can be found in other villages of this age, the present church in Liepen is relatively new. It was commissioned in 1886 from a Neustrelitz master builder after the old half-timbered church could no longer be used due to dilapidation. The damage this church had suffered during the Thirty Years' War had only been repaired in a makeshift manner. The builder was Baron von Kapherr, the then landowner of Klein Vielen. The new church, which had now been built at the village entrance, was consecrated as early as November 1888. https://www.kirche-liepen.de/die-kirche

Frequently Asked Questions

How many family-friendly hiking trails are available around Kratzeburg?

There are over 100 family-friendly hiking trails around Kratzeburg, ranging from easy strolls to more moderate excursions. More than half of these, 51 routes, are specifically rated as easy, making them ideal for families with children.

What kind of terrain can we expect on family hikes in Kratzeburg?

The terrain around Kratzeburg is wonderfully varied and generally gentle, making it perfect for families. You'll find paths winding through extensive forests, including ancient beech forests, alongside numerous sparkling lakes like the Käbelicksee, and across open landscapes. Many trails feature soft ground underfoot, offering a comfortable experience for all ages.

What is the best time of year for family hiking in Kratzeburg?

Spring and autumn are particularly beautiful for family hikes in Kratzeburg. In spring, the forests burst with new life and migratory birds return, while autumn offers stunning foliage colors. Summer is also great, especially with opportunities for swimming in the lakes, but trails can be busier. Winter offers a quiet, serene experience, though some paths might be less accessible depending on snow conditions.

Are there any easy or short trails suitable for young children or toddlers?

Yes, Kratzeburg offers several easy and short trails perfect for young children. The Swimming spot at Granziner See – View of Lake Käbelick loop from Kratzeburg is a good option, providing beautiful lake views without being too long. Additionally, the region features the 3.5 km long, barrier-free SpurenWeg (Trace Trail) between Kratzeburg and Dambeck, which is suitable for people with visual impairments and also great for families with strollers.

What natural landmarks or viewpoints can we discover on family hikes?

Family hikes around Kratzeburg offer many natural highlights. You can explore the vast Müritz National Park itself, which is a UNESCO World Heritage site. Don't miss the Käflingsberg Observation Tower for panoramic views, or visit the tranquil Source of the Havel River. Keep an eye out for the Stork Nest in Groß Quassow for a unique wildlife viewing opportunity.

Can we spot any wildlife while hiking with our family in Müritz National Park?

Absolutely! Müritz National Park is a haven for wildlife. Families can often spot endangered large birds like ospreys, white-tailed eagles, and cranes, making it an excellent spot for birdwatching. Red deer and beavers also inhabit the area. The numerous lakes and forests provide diverse habitats, increasing your chances of a memorable wildlife encounter.

Are there circular routes suitable for families around Kratzeburg?

Yes, there are several excellent circular routes ideal for families. The Hike around the Käbelicksee - Müritz National Park is a popular circular trail offering beautiful lake views. Another great option is the View of Lake Käbelick – National Park Village Granzin loop, which takes you through the national park's scenic landscapes.

Is public transport available to access hiking trails in Kratzeburg?

Kratzeburg is well-integrated into the regional public transport network, making it accessible for hikers. Buses connect Kratzeburg with surrounding towns and national park entry points. For detailed schedules and routes, it's best to check local transport information, especially when planning to reach specific trailheads within the Müritz National Park.

Are there places to eat or stay near the family-friendly trails in Kratzeburg?

Yes, Kratzeburg and the surrounding villages offer various amenities for families. You'll find guesthouses and holiday apartments for accommodation. For dining, there are local restaurants and cafes where you can enjoy regional cuisine. The National Park Information Center "Kratzeburger Flatterhus" also provides information about local services and attractions.

Are dogs allowed on family hiking trails in Kratzeburg?

Dogs are generally welcome on many hiking trails around Kratzeburg, especially outside the core protection zones of the Müritz National Park. However, within the National Park, dogs must be kept on a leash to protect wildlife. Always check local signage or the specific trail regulations before heading out with your furry friend to ensure a pleasant and respectful experience for everyone.

Are there any specific information centers for the Müritz National Park nearby?

Yes, the National Park Information Center "Kratzeburger Flatterhus" is located directly in Kratzeburg. It offers valuable insights into the region's sights, natural features, and wildlife, including an exhibition about bats. It's a great first stop for families to gather information and plan their hiking adventures. You can also find more general information about the park at mueritz-nationalpark.de.
